USciences is in the top 10% of the country for health studies. More specifically it was ranked #33 out of 398 schools by College Factual. It is also ranked #3 in Pennsylvania.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of the Sciences handed out 54 bachelor's degrees in general health services/allied health/health sciences. This is a decrease of 8% over the previous year when 59 degrees were handed out.

The health studies program at USciences awarded 54 bachelor's degrees in 2020-2021. About 37% of these degrees went to men with the other 63% going to women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of the Sciences with a bachelor's in health studies.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 24 |
Black or African American | 2 |
Hispanic or Latino | 4 |
White | 19 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 5 |
